    SMS Deliverer is an enterprise-grade on-premise SMS gateway and communication automation platform designed for organizations that need secure, private, and fully controlled messaging infrastructure. The platform supports GSM and LTE modems, GSM dongles, Android devices, SMS messaging, MMS multimedia communication, USSD functionality, and automated voice call broadcasting within one unified system. SMS Deliverer allows businesses to create their own private messaging infrastructure without depending on third-party cloud communication providers or recurring per-message billing models. The software is built for organizations that prioritize data sovereignty, security, regulatory compliance, and operational reliability across internal and customer-facing communication workflows. All sent and received messages are stored locally on the organization’s infrastructure, ensuring sensitive communication data never leaves the business environment. SMS Deliverer includes advanced enterprise integration features such as SMPP v3.4 server support, RESTful HTTP APIs, real-time webhooks, and native SQL database connectivity for MySQL, Oracle, and Microsoft SQL Server systems. The platform can integrate directly with business software, automation systems, monitoring platforms, CRM solutions, and operational databases to support large-scale messaging workflows. Businesses can use SMS Deliverer for two-way SMS communication, OTP authentication, system monitoring alerts, customer support automation, service notifications, marketing campaigns, and automated voice messaging. The platform also includes work-time scheduling features that allow organizations to control when automated communications are sent to customers. SMS Deliverer is optimized for mission-critical environments where reliable message delivery, low latency, and infrastructure independence are essential.

    SMSEagle is a hardware-based SMS gateway that enables the direct transmission of SMS messages to a telecom carrier, bypassing third-party services and the Internet. It operates using a SIM card and features built-in modules along with an external antenna to connect directly to a telecommunications provider, functioning similarly to mobile phones. Often referred to as SMS servers, these hardware SMS gateways combine both hardware and software components to facilitate communication management. Moreover, the device offers multiple integration options with external systems, including APIs and Email to SMS services, enhancing its versatility and usability in various applications.
